Donald Trump to Chair UN Security Council
Nuclear non-proliferation and Iran will be on the US president's agenda
Nuclear non-proliferation and Iran will be on President Trump's agenda when he chairs a meeting of the United Nations Security Council for the first time. In his combative address to the UN General Assembly yesterday, Mr Trump singled out Tehran for spreading chaos and destruction.
Also in the programme: Libya's coast guard tells the BBC that NGO rescue boats encourage migrants to make the dangerous crossing of the Mediterranean; and the Indian Supreme Court has imposed limits on the use of the world's largest biometric identity system.
